Fiat Chrysler announced the recall of more than 494 thousand pickups and trucks

Fiat Chrysler Automobiles announced the recall of more than 494 thousand pickups and trucks worldwide because of a problem in the water pump that could potentially cause a fire.

The company said there were no reports of injuries or accidents related to this problem, which affects pick-up Ram 2500 and Ram 3500 from 2013 to 2017, as well as trucks without body models 3500, 4500 and 5500. In a press release, Fiat Chrysler stated that this review is limited to models with 6.7-liter engines, and also noted that she no longer equips the vehicle this water pump.

“Because of customer complaints an investigation was launched by the FCA in the United States, which showed that some trucks water pump can under certain conditions overheat and potentially cause fire in the engine compartment, — reported in a press release. — Problems with the water pump can lead to activation of the signal lamp on the front panel. Customers are strongly advised to consult their dealers whenever they see the warning signals”.

The limit of detection of the potential threat of fire is quite wide. A company representative stated that, in accordance with the regulatory definition, which includes everything from the smell to the open flame, only a small number of such incidents. Even less to do with some prejudice, and none of the incidents resulted in damage beyond the region of the pump.
